متن کاملRemote Raman detection of Feldspars under daylight condition using a compact remote Raman+LIBS+Fluorescence system
Introduction: The detection of minerals using remote analytical techniques has the advantage of performing rapid chemical analysis of a variety of targets without sample collection. This saves significant time in planetary explorations using rovers and provides a large number of targets accessible to a lander near its landing site. متن کاملHighly Selective Standoff Detection and Imaging of Trace Chemicals in a Complex Background using Single-Beam Coherent Anti-Stokes Raman Spectroscopy
A sensitive, non-destructive and highly selective method of standoff detection using coherent anti-Stokes Raman spectroscopy (CARS) is presented. The approach uses a single amplified femtosecond laser to generate high resolution (<10cm) multiplex CARS spectra encompassing the fingerprint region (400cm – 2500cm) at standoff distance.
